PARK MAINTENANCE ASSISTANT (PERMANENT INTERMITTENT) / NORTH COAST REDWOODS DISTRICT / FORT HUMBOLDT STATE HISTORIC PARK

The reporting location for this is Reporting location 3431 Fort Avenue, Eureka, CA 95503 Fort Humboldt State Historic Park. This position works under the supervision of the Park Maintenance Supervisor. Work schedule is Sunday through Thursday 8:00 to 4:30 PM

The Park Maintenance Assistant performs routine facility maintenance, housekeeping, and groundskeeping duties to support park operations and ensure that park facilities remain safe, clean, and functional for visitors and staff. Duties include cleaning restrooms and public facilities, picking up litter and debris in day-use areas and parking lots, maintaining trails and grounds, and assisting with minor maintenance and repair projects. Assist with a variety of maintenance activities including painting, carpentry, plumbing, trail maintenance, and general facility upkeep. This position may also assist with vegetation maintenance, operate maintenance equipment such as mowers, blowers, and other power tools, and perform minor maintenance on tools and equipment. May lead and train seasonal staff.
